Abstract

An optical information recording medium includes a recording layer that absorbs recording light in accordance with its wavelength, the recording light being condensed for information recording, and increases the temperature in the vicinity of a focus so as to form a recording mark and that has properties of increasing a light absorption amount with respect to the wavelength of the recording lightwhen light having the wavelength of the recording light is radiated.

Description

technical field [0001] The present invention relates to an optical information recording medium preferably used as an optical information recording medium in which, for example, information is recorded using a light beam and information is reproduced using a light beam. Background technique [0002] In the past, disc-shaped optical information recording media have been widely used as optical information recording media, and compact discs (CDs), digital versatile discs (DVDs), Blu-ray Discs (registered trademark, hereinafter referred to as BDs) and the like are generally used.
